交互式遗传算法的机器代替用户方法*

Keywords: 交互式遗传算法,机器代替用户,偏好漂移,基因意义单元

Full-Text   Cite this paper   Add to My Lib

Abstract:

如何让无疲劳的计算机代替易疲劳的用户是交互式遗传算法研究的一个重要内容.本文首先研究了机器代替用户的3个基本内容,即,机器代替用户扮演环境角色,对个体进行评价;机器采样和代替用户的时机是进入偏好稳定阶段;机器寻优结果由样本和代替用户策略决定.其次,给出基于基因意义单元“适应值”估计的个体适应值估计方法.最后,通过比较实验验证了本文方法的有效性.
